CAF Champions League Match Report: Township Rollers 0-1 Kaizer Chiefs

CAF Champions League Score: Township Rollers 0-1 Kaizer Chiefs Date: 28 February 2015 Venue: National Stadium Kaizer Chiefs defeated Township Rollers 1-0 at the National Stadium to secure their spot in the next round of qualifying for the CAF Champions League. Chiefs dominated right from the onset, as they did in the first leg, and had an early effort at goal, as Bernard Parker forced Masule into a low save, while they were also denied a penalty in the fifth minute, after Siphiwe Tshabalala was brought down in the area. Despite their dominance, Stuart Baxter's side were restricted to long range efforts, none of which troubled the Rollers shot-topper. Chiefs eventually took advantage of their dominance in the 27th minute, as Siyabonga Nkosi got on the end of Matthew Rusike's knockdown before rifling the ball past a helpless Masule. Township Rollers, meanwhile, struggled to get their attacking game going and were often left frustrated by Eric Mathoho and Tefu Mashamaite, while they failed to register an effort target in the opening 45 minutes. Rollers started seeing a bit more of the ball in the second half, although they looked even more dangerous with the set-pieces. Chiefs hardly entered Rollers' final third in the second half, as Baxter brought on Morgan Gould with his side leading 3-1 on aggregate. Chiefs managed to see off any late surge from the Botswana side to confirm their place in the next round of qualifying.
